Bukobot (or just Buko) is the 3D printer designed by Deezmaker. The intent of this DIY 3D printer is to create a new generation of Repraps based on this framework. Here are some highlights:

The "Bukobot" low cost Open Source 3D Printer with a roll of Blue ABS filament
  • Aluminium frame
  • Very easily expandable in any direction
  • Designed to handle Dual (or even more in theory) extruders with very little effort
  • Very minimal calibration or adjustments of frame
  • No laser cut parts
  • No special machined parts (except for maybe an extruder hot end)
  • Much lower cost than most RepRaps without sacrificing rigidity
  • Can be used with nearly any combination of electronics
  • Takes advantage of new common materials like UHMW & Synchromesh Cables
  • Designed to easily purpose (upgrade) an existing RepRap like the Prusa Mendel and Printrbot
